Assess Your Environment



When you examine your environment, you'll swiftly realize that your roof covering product needs to hold up against specific climate condition.

Beginning by reviewing the temperature ranges in your location. If you live in a location with severe warmth, think about materials that reflect sunshine, like metal or tile. These alternatives help keep your home cooler and reduce energy costs.

If you're in a hurricane-prone zone, search for products ranked for high winds, such as impact-resistant roof shingles or metal roof coverings.

Don't ignore moisture levels, either. In damp climates, opt for materials that resist mold and mildew and mold, like metal or dealt with wood.

Last but not least, take into consideration the sunlight direct exposure your roofing system gets. If it remains in straight sunshine the majority of the day, UV-resistant materials will certainly extend its lifespan.

Assess Upkeep Demands



On a regular basis reviewing upkeep demands is critical when picking roofing products. Different materials featured differing upkeep requirements, which can considerably impact your long-term expenses and efforts.

For instance, asphalt roof shingles generally require less upkeep contrasted to wood trembles, which require regular treatments to avoid rot and bug damages.

Think about how much effort and time you're willing to buy maintenance. If you choose low-maintenance choices, materials like metal or floor tile roofs might be more suitable. These options normally last longer and resist weather-related wear, meaning fewer repair work down the line.


Consider your neighborhood environment as well. If you live in an area prone to extreme weather condition, pick a material that can withstand those problems without regular maintenance.

It's additionally a good idea to investigate the particular requirements for the materials you're considering. Explore just how commonly they need inspections, cleaning, or fixings.

Don't forget to factor in specialist help. Some materials may necessitate expert maintenance, which can add to your general costs.
